Understanding the Core Gameplay of Aviator
The fundamental principle of Aviator revolves around a simple yet compelling premise: watch an airplane take off and increase its multiplier. Players place bets before each round, and as the plane ascends, the multiplier grows exponentially. The longer the plane stays airborne, the higher the multiplier—and the greater the potential payout. However, the plane can „fly away“ at any moment, resulting in a loss of the stake. It is up to the player to decide when to cash out and secure their winnings, making timing crucial.
This element of chance and skill is what makes Aviator so appealing. It’s not just about luck; it’s about calculated risk and knowing when to seize the opportunity. The game also usually features an auto-cashout function, which allows players to pre-set a multiplier target for their winnings, automatically cashing out once that target is reached. The ability to use auto-cashout is a valuable tool for managing risk and staying disciplined in the face of rising multipliers.

The Importance of Bankroll Management
Effective bankroll management is paramount in any form of gambling, and Aviator is no exception. Before even launching the aviator demo, determine a fixed amount you’re willing to risk and treat it as disposable income, never chasing losses or betting more than you can afford to lose. A common strategy is to bet only a small percentage of your total bankroll per round, typically between 1% and 5%. This ensures that even a series of unsuccessful rounds won’t deplete your funds prematurely.
Consider implementing a stop-loss limit—a predetermined amount of loss that triggers you to stop playing. Equally important is setting a win goal. Once you reach that goal, cash out and walk away. This prevents overconfidence from clouding your judgment and potentially leading to losing your accumulated winnings. Disciplined bankroll management is not about guaranteeing victories; it’s about mitigating risk and prolonging your playtime.
Understanding the Random Number Generator (RNG)
At the heart of Aviator, as with most online casino games, lies a Random Number Generator (RNG). This is a sophisticated algorithm that ensures fairness and unpredictability in each round. The RNG generates random numbers, determining the point at which the airplane will “fly away.” This means that every round is independent of the previous ones; past results have absolutely no influence on future outcomes.
Understanding this is crucial for debunking common myths and fallacies. There’s no “hot streak” or “cold streak” in Aviator; each round has an equal chance of resulting in a high or low multiplier. Relying on patterns or “systems” based on past results is statistically unsound.
